函数substr什么意思

发布时间:2024-11-19 06:30:36

在PHP编程言语中,substr函数是一个非常有效的字符串处理东西,它用于截取字符串中的一部分。本文将具体阐明substr函数的含义、用处以及怎样利用它。 总结来说,substr函数容许开辟者在给定字符串中指定肇端地位跟长度,以获取子字符串。这在处理用户输入、文本截取或数据格局化等场景中尤为有效。

substr函数的含义

substr函数在PHP中是“substring”的缩写,直译为“子字符串”。该函数用来从一个较长的字符串中提取出一段子字符串。函数原型如下: substr(string $string, int $start, ?int $length = null): string 其中,$string是原始字符串,$start是子字符串的肇端地位,$length是可选参数,表示要截取的字符串长度。

substr函数的用处

substr函数常用于以下场景:

  • 从一个长文本中提取摘要或标题。
  • 处理用户输入,比方获取邮箱地点的用户名部分。
  • 截取文件名或道路的一部分。
  • 在表现数据时停止格局化处理,比方只表现部分信息。

substr函数的用法

下面经由过程一些示例来展示substr函数的具体用法:

  • 获取字符串的一部分:$part = substr($string, 5, 10); // 从索引5开端,截取10个字符
  • 从开端截取到字符串末端:$part = substr($string, 5); // 从索引5开端截取到字符串末端
  • 正数索引的利用:$part = substr($string, -5); // 从倒数第五个字符开端截取到字符串末端

总结

substr函数在PHP编程顶用于实现字符串的截取操纵,非常机动跟便利。开辟者可能根据须要截取字符串的差别部分,以顺应差其余编程须要。纯熟控制substr函数,可能大年夜大年夜进步处理字符串的效力。